American Idol returns to ABC tonight but without one familiar face at the judges’ table. After seven seasons, Katy Perry announced that Season 22 would be her last, with her replacement being the legendary Carrie Underwood.

The Grammy-winning county singer, who first rose to fame as the winner of American Idol in 2005, will take over Perry’s seat when the new season premieres on Sunday, March 9. Alongside Lionel Richie and Luke Bryan, she will be part of this new chapter.
Richie had only good things to say, including that Underwood is a “jukebox… she knows every song that the contestants are singing,”. He joked that she couldn’t help joining in and needed to be reminded that she was a judge.
Why Did Katy Perry Leave American Idol?

In February 2024, Katy Perry announced that she was leaving American Idol after Season 22 to focus on her pop career and release new music. During an appearance on Jimmy Kimmel Live!, she shared that she “loved the show so much” and that it had made her feel “connected with the heart of America,” but she needed to “feel that pulse to my own beat.”
Who’s Replacing Katy Perry On American Idol?

Underwood was officially announced as Perry’s replacement on Good Morning America in August 2024. She spoke with great passion and mentioned, “I went from nobody knowing my name to tens of millions of people watching the show,” I’m proud of everything that I was able to accomplish on the show and I’m so proud of everything that I’ve accomplished since.”
When Did Carrie Underwood Win American Idol?

Underwood won Season 4 of American Idol in 2005 at 21 years old, with Simon Cowell, Paula Abdul, and Randy Jackson serving as judges. For her audition, she performed Bonnie Raitt’s “I Can’t Make You Love Me.”

Since winning American Idol, Underwood has released 9 studio albums and earned 8 Grammy Awards, making her one of country music’s biggest stars. With over 85 million records sold worldwide, she is set to conclude her Las Vegas residency, REFLECTION: The Las Vegas Residency, in April 2025.
We can surely expect great things from her. American Idol Season 23 premieres on Sunday, March 9 at 8 p.m. ET/PT on ABC. New episodes will be available the next day on Hulu.
